The prehistoric reptiles known as dinosaurs arose during the middle to late triassic period of the mesozoic era, some 230 million years ago. Most triassic dinosaurs were small predators and only a few were common, such as coelophysis, which was 1 to 2 metres (3.3 to 6.6 ft) long.
